华为云服务器建站教程,华为云服务器怎么安装可视化桌面
- 综合资讯
- 2024-10-01 11:49:03
- 4

***:本内容主要涉及华为云服务器相关知识。一方面聚焦于华为云服务器建站教程,这可能涵盖从服务器环境搭建到网站部署等一系列步骤;另一方面关注华为云服务器安装可视化桌面的...
***:本内容聚焦华为云服务器相关操作。一方面涉及华为云服务器建站教程,可能涵盖从服务器初始设置到网站搭建各环节步骤;另一方面关注华为云服务器安装可视化桌面,这也许包括安装前的准备工作,如系统要求、软件资源等,以及具体的安装流程,包括可能用到的工具、命令和配置操作等,旨在为用户使用华为云服务器进行建站和安装可视化桌面提供指导。
本文目录导读:
《华为云服务器安装可视化桌面全攻略》
随着云计算的广泛应用,华为云服务器以其高性能、可靠性和安全性受到众多用户的欢迎,在很多场景下,我们可能需要在华为云服务器上安装可视化桌面,以便更直观地进行操作和管理,本文将详细介绍华为云服务器安装可视化桌面的步骤和相关知识。
准备工作
(一)华为云服务器的选择与配置
1、服务器类型
- 根据需求选择合适的华为云服务器类型,如通用计算型、内存优化型等,如果是用于安装可视化桌面且可能会运行一些图形密集型应用,内存优化型可能更为合适。
- 确保服务器的计算资源(CPU、内存等)能够满足可视化桌面运行的要求,对于基本的可视化操作,2核4GB内存的配置可以作为一个起始选择,但如果要运行复杂的图形软件,可能需要更高的配置,如4核8GB或更多。
2、操作系统选择
- 华为云服务器支持多种操作系统,如Linux(Ubuntu、CentOS等)和Windows Server,对于可视化桌面安装,如果选择Windows Server,其本身具有较好的图形界面支持,安装过程相对较为直接,而如果选择Linux系统,则需要额外安装桌面环境和相关的远程桌面协议支持软件。
(二)网络设置
1、安全组规则
- 在华为云控制台中,配置服务器的安全组规则,确保允许相关的端口访问,如果使用远程桌面协议(RDP)进行Windows可视化桌面连接,需要开放3389端口;如果是基于Linux系统使用VNC等协议,需要开放对应的端口(如5900 + 桌面编号等)。
2、公网IP分配
- 为了能够从外部网络访问云服务器上的可视化桌面,需要为服务器分配公网IP,可以在华为云服务器的网络设置中选择弹性公网IP,并将其绑定到服务器实例上。
三、在Windows Server上安装可视化桌面
(一)连接到云服务器
1、使用远程桌面连接工具
- 在本地Windows计算机上,打开“远程桌面连接”程序,输入华为云服务器的公网IP地址,点击“连接”。
- 根据提示输入服务器的管理员账号和密码,登录到服务器。
(二)安装桌面体验功能(以Windows Server 2019为例)
1、打开“服务器管理器”
- 在服务器桌面上,找到“服务器管理器”图标并打开。
2、添加角色和功能
- 在“服务器管理器”中,选择“添加角色和功能”,在向导中,选择“基于角色或基于功能的安装”,然后点击“下一步”。
- 选择服务器(通常为本地服务器),点击“下一步”。
- 在“服务器角色”页面中,选择“桌面体验”,这将安装Windows Server的完整桌面环境,包括开始菜单、任务栏等图形界面元素。
- 按照向导提示完成安装过程,可能需要重启服务器。
在Linux系统上安装可视化桌面
(一)选择桌面环境
1、常见桌面环境
- 对于Ubuntu系统,可以选择GNOME、KDE等桌面环境,GNOME具有简洁、易用的特点,而KDE则提供了丰富的定制功能,对于CentOS系统,可以选择GNOME或者Xfce等桌面环境。
- 以Ubuntu系统安装GNOME桌面环境为例。
(二)安装桌面环境
1、更新系统
- 通过SSH连接到华为云服务器的Ubuntu系统,在命令行中输入“sudo apt - get update”和“sudo apt - get upgrade”,以更新系统软件包到最新版本。
2、安装GNOME桌面环境
- 输入命令“sudo apt - get install ubuntu - desktop”,这将开始下载和安装GNOME桌面环境及其相关的依赖包,安装过程可能需要较长时间,取决于服务器的网络速度和计算资源。
- 在安装过程中,可能会提示输入管理员密码或者进行一些配置选择,按照提示操作即可。
(三)安装远程桌面协议支持(以VNC为例)
1、安装VNC服务器软件
- 在Ubuntu系统中,可以安装TightVNC或者RealVNC等软件,以TightVNC为例,输入命令“sudo apt - get install tightvncserver”。
2、配置VNC服务器
- 启动VNC服务器,输入“vncserver”命令,这将提示设置VNC连接密码等信息。
- 编辑VNC配置文件(通常位于~/.vnc/xstartup),将默认的内容修改为适合GNOME桌面环境的启动脚本,将文件内容修改为:
```bash
#!/bin/bash
export XKL_XMODMAP_DISABLE=1
unset SESSION_MANAGER
unset DBUS_SESSION_BUS_ADDRESS
gnome - session &
```
- 重启VNC服务器,使配置生效。
连接到可视化桌面
(一)Windows可视化桌面连接
1、使用远程桌面连接
- 在本地计算机上,打开“远程桌面连接”程序,输入华为云服务器的公网IP地址,点击“连接”,输入服务器的管理员账号和密码(如果是Windows Server安装了桌面体验功能),即可进入可视化桌面。
(二)Linux可视化桌面连接
1、使用VNC客户端
- 在本地计算机上,下载并安装VNC客户端软件,如RealVNC Viewer或者TightVNC Viewer。
- 打开VNC客户端,输入华为云服务器的公网IP地址和VNC连接端口(默认为5901,如果启动了多个VNC桌面,端口依次递增),点击“连接”,输入在服务器上设置的VNC连接密码,即可连接到Linux系统的可视化桌面。
优化可视化桌面体验
(一)性能优化
1、调整显示设置
- 在Windows可视化桌面中,可以调整显示分辨率、颜色深度等设置,以适应本地设备和网络带宽,在Linux可视化桌面中,也可以通过桌面环境的显示设置来进行类似的调整。
2、优化网络设置
- 如果可视化桌面的响应速度较慢,可以在华为云控制台中调整服务器的网络带宽,或者优化本地网络环境,对于远程桌面连接,也可以调整远程桌面连接工具中的网络优化选项,如降低显示质量以提高响应速度等。
(二)安全增强
1、定期更新系统
- 无论是Windows还是Linux系统,都要定期更新系统补丁,以修复安全漏洞,在Windows Server中,可以通过“服务器管理器”中的“更新服务”进行更新;在Linux系统中,可以使用包管理器(如apt - get或yum)进行系统更新。
2、加强账号管理
- 为可视化桌面设置强密码,并限制账号的登录权限,在Windows系统中,可以通过本地安全策略进行账号管理;在Linux系统中,可以使用用户管理命令(如useradd、passwd等)和配置文件(如/etc/passwd、/etc/shadow等)来管理账号。
通过以上步骤,我们可以在华为云服务器上成功安装和连接可视化桌面,无论是Windows系统还是Linux系统,都有其各自的安装和配置方法,在实际操作过程中,需要根据具体的需求和服务器资源情况进行调整和优化,以获得最佳的可视化桌面体验,也要注重服务器的安全管理,确保数据和操作的安全性。
本文链接:https://www.zhitaoyun.cn/109227.html
发表评论